Understanding Mobile Threats and the Role of Dedicated Recovery Apps
While device theft remains a tangible threat, the ever-adaptable cybercriminal landscape has expanded to include sophisticated hacking, phishing, and unauthorized data extraction. Consequently, the importance of comprehensive recovery solutions has intensified, shifting from mere theft deterrents to robust, authoritative recovery tools capable of maintaining user privacy and device integrity.
Traditional methods such as remote wiping and device tracking partners like Apple’s Find My or Google’s Find My Service, predominantly rely on cloud-based services. However, these solutions are sometimes cumbersome, intermittently unreliable, or insufficient for immediate recovery. As such, specialized applications that combine automated alerts, real-time device monitoring, and comprehensive data protections are gaining prominence within professional cybersecurity ecosystems.
Introducing Advanced Mobile Recall and Theft Recovery Strategies
Leading industry professionals emphasize that integrating multifaceted security apps offers a paradigm shift in device protection. These solutions leverage technologies such as biometric verification, location tracking, and remote access controls—not only to deter theft but to facilitate rapid, verified recovery when incidents occur. An emerging approach involves utilizing dedicated recovery apps designed with sophisticated features tailored for user empowerment and data integrity.
| Feature | Description | Industry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Real-Time Location Tracking | Continuous GPS monitoring enables immediate location updates, increasing the chance of recovery. | Enhances law enforcement collaboration and recovery rates. |
| Automated Alerts & Notifications | Immediate user notifications if suspicious activity is detected. | Reduces false alarms and accelerates response times. |
| Remote Lock & Wipe | Authoritative command to lock device or erase personal data remotely. | Mitigates data breaches, even if recovery isn’t possible. |
| Photo & Video Capture | Invisible activation of camera to gather evidence discreetly. | Provides critical proof for law enforcement to identify culprits. |
